以太坊全节点与轻节点钱包的区别详解
引言
以太坊作为一种广受欢迎的区块链平台,提供了多种钱包类型以满足不同用户的需求。在以太坊钱包的生态系统中,全节点钱包和轻节点钱包是两种主要的选择。每种钱包都有其独特的特性和适用场景,对于初学者和资深用户来说,了解两者的区别是非常重要的,这有助于用户选择最符合自己需求的钱包。本文将对以太坊全节点钱包与轻节点钱包进行深入的分析和对比,帮助用户在使用以太坊时做出明智的决策。
全节点钱包与轻节点钱包概述
首先,让我们了解一下全节点钱包和轻节点钱包的基本定义。
全节点钱包是指在以太坊网络中,能够存储整个区块链数据的节点。这种钱包下载整个链的数据并在本地进行验证,确保所有交易的有效性和真实性。使用全节点钱包的用户能够独立验证区块链数据,不需要依赖其他节点,提供了较高的安全性和隐私保护。
相对而言,轻节点钱包则不需要下载整个区块链数据,而是通过连接到全节点来获取和验证信息。这使得轻节点钱包在存储和带宽方面更加轻便,适合手机用户或对区块链数据需求不高的用户。轻节点钱包使用较少的资源,这使得它的运行更加高效。
全节点钱包的优缺点
全节点钱包的选择对于代币的存储和管理具备独特的好处和劣势。
优点:
- 安全性强:全节点钱包本地保存整个区块链数据,用户无需信任第三方服务。这确保了用户的私钥和交易信息的安全,不容易受到黑客攻击。
- 增强隐私:由于全节点可以独立验证交易,用户的交易信息不会被第三方节点记录,能够提供更高的隐私保护。
- 参与网络维护:全节点钱包帮助维护以太坊网络的健康,贡献计算资源和存储空间,增强网络的整体安全性和稳定性。
缺点:
- 资源消耗大:全节点需要下载整个区块链数据,这占用大量的存储空间和带宽,对于普通用户来说,运行全节点可能会出现资源不足的问题。
- 设置复杂:对于技术水平不高的用户,设置和维护全节点钱包可能会比较复杂,通常需要一定的技术基础。
轻节点钱包的优缺点
轻节点钱包便于使用,但同样也有其优缺点。
优点:
- 轻便易用:轻节点钱包不需要下载整个区块链,只需要联网到全节点,就能快速访问区块链信息,非常适合移动端用户或对区块链技术不熟悉的用户。
- 节省资源:轻节点钱包在存储和带宽上消耗有限,不需要大容量硬盘和高速度的网络连接,可以运作在资源较少的环境中。
- 快速交易验证:由于只需通过全节点进行信息请求和验证,轻节点钱包的交易速度相对较快。
缺点:
- 安全性较低:轻节点钱包依赖于全节点,对于网络中的恶意全节点可能难以进行有效的验证,用户的个人隐私和资金安全可能受到威胁。
- 隐私保护较弱:通过轻节点进行交易验证时,用户的交易信息可能被记录和监控,隐私与匿名性受到影响。
选择合适的钱包
选择全节点钱包还是轻节点钱包,取决于用户的需求和使用场景。对于那些重视安全性和隐私的用户,特别是需要长时间存储以太坊资产的投资者,全节点钱包无疑是一个更好的选择。而对于那些更注重便捷性且不涉及大量资金的普通用户,轻节点钱包则提供了很好的解决方案。
可能的相关问题
1. 全节点钱包的设置和维护难度如何?
全节点钱包的设置通常相对复杂,需要用户具备一定的技术背景。首先,用户需要下载以太坊的完整软件,这可以从以太坊官网或GitHub获取。安装过程中,用户需确保本地系统满足其所需的运行环境,包括适当的内存、处理器及硬盘空间。下载整个区块链数据可能需要数小时甚至数天的时间,这取决于用户的网络带宽和计算机性能。同时,配置节点,确保其能够与网络稳定连接,也需要技术知识。
对于维护,全节点钱包也需要定期更新,以确保安全性和兼容性。用户需要关注以太坊网络及其协议的更新,并根据官方的指引进行相应的升级。此外,用户需要定期备份钱包数据以防丢失。
综合来看,尽管全节点钱包提供了更高的安全性和隐私保护,但对普通用户而言,设置和维护的难度可能成为一个障碍。因此,不具备相关技术知识的用户在选择全节点钱包时需谨慎考虑。
2. 轻节点钱包在什么情况下适合使用?
轻节点钱包由于其轻便性和易用性,适合在以下几种情况下使用:
移动设备使用:许多用户希望在手机等移动设备上方便地管理他们的以太坊资产,而轻节点钱包便能完美满足这一需求。由于轻节点不要求用户下载整个区块链,用户可以在不占用大量手机存储的情况下,随时随地进行交易。
普通用户或新手:对于那些刚接触以太坊的用户,轻节点钱包的用户界面通常更为友好,且不需要深刻理解区块链原理。用户可以快速进行交易,体验以太坊生态系统的魅力,而不需要承担全节点的复杂性。
快速转账交易:轻节点钱包由于依赖于全节点的信息,通常在交易速度上表现更好。因此,对于希望进行快速转账的用户,轻节点钱包会是更好的选择。
不过,用户在使用轻节点钱包时需要注意安全和隐私的问题,选择值得信任的钱包提供商至关重要。
3. 如何提高全节点钱包的安全性?
对于使用全节点钱包的用户,提高安全性是极为重要的,特别是对比特币或以太坊这类资产进行存储时。以下是一些提升全节点钱包安全性的建议:
1. 硬件防护:用户应该将全节点钱包设置在安全的环境中。使用强大的防火墙和病毒防护软件,确保计算机上没有恶意软件或病毒感染。一些用户还选择将钱包运行在专用的硬件设备上,以减少网络攻击的风险。
2. 定期备份:全节点钱包应定期备份,以防资料丢失。用户可以在本地硬盘和外部存储设备中保留多个备份,同时建议将重要的资料加密存储。
3. 保护私钥:私钥的安全性至关重要,用户应该尽量避免将私钥保存在在线环境中,使用冷存储(如纸钱包或硬件钱包)进行存储是更加安全的选择。
4. 使用安全网络:在进行与全节点钱包相关的操作时,用户应使用安全的网络环境,尽量避免在公共Wi-Fi上操作钱包,以防止信息被截取。
通过以上措施,用户可以大幅提高全节点钱包的安全性,确保他们的以太坊资产得到充分保护。
4. 全节点钱包与轻节点钱包的未来发展趋势是什么?
随着区块链技术的不断发展,全节点钱包和轻节点钱包都面临着技术革新和应用场景的扩展。以下是关于它们未来发展的几点思考:
全节点钱包的发展:随着以太坊网络的壮大,区块链数据的增长将会加速,全节点钱包可能需要新的技术来处理日益增加的数据存储需求。未来,全节点钱包或许会结合云计算技术,允许用户在云端进行数据存储和处理,从而减少对本地硬件的依赖,提高使用的便捷性和高效性。
轻节点钱包的发展:轻节点钱包未来的主要发展方向可能在于安全性和用户体验的提升。由于现有轻节点钱包在安全性上面临一定挑战,未来可能会引入更多的技术,如多重签名、去中心化身份等,以增强用户保护。同时,轻节点钱包界面和功能的也将是主要的改进方向,以吸引更多新用户。
合并发展:未来,我们可能会看到全节点与轻节点结合的解决方案,可以充分利用两者的优点。在保证安全性的同时,满足用户对轻松操作的需求。这样的钱包将能够提供更多灵活的功能,旨在解决当前用户在使用全节点和轻节点方面的痛点。
综上所述,全节点钱包和轻节点钱包各自适合不同的用户场群,了解它们的区别和特点,有助于用户做出明智的选择。在以太坊日益普及的今天,选择合适的钱包,不仅确保了资产的安全,更能提高用户的使用体验。
结论
整体来看,选择以太坊全节点钱包或轻节点钱包需视具体情境和用户需求而定。全节点钱包在安全性和隐私性上更具优势,适合长时间进行资金存储的用户;而轻节点钱包以其便捷性和高效性为特点,更适合初学者或日常交易较多的用户。了解这些工具的本质特点,有助于用户在以太坊的数字资产管理中做出更为明智的决策。